Problems solved by technology

If the thermocouple directly measures the temperature of the workpiece, high voltage will be introduced into the temperature control instrument, thus burning the instrument
And the surface of the product is in a plasma state, the complex interference of the electric field and magnetic field will also affect the potential difference of the thermocouple, and the DC pulse power supply itself sends out a 1KHz high-frequency signal, which will also generate an induced potential and affect the output signal of the thermocouple. So that the measured temperature is different from the actual temperature

Abstract

A direct temperature measuring device comprises a temperature measuring assembly and a digital display instrument. The temperature measuring assembly comprises a shell and at least one flexible thermocouple installed inside the shell. A heat insulation material coating the flexible thermocouples is arranged inside the shell. Each flexible thermocouple has a measuring end and a connecting end. Inside the shell, at least one insulating layer is arranged in parallel at one side of the measuring ends of the flexible thermocouples. Outside the shell, a vacuum sealing layer extends from the end face of the shell at one side of the connecting ends of the flexible thermocouples. The connecting ends of the flexible thermocouples are connected with the digital display instrument. The measuring end of each flexible thermocouple is a plane, and the width of the widest part is 0.5-2mm. The direct temperature measuring device further comprises a signal isolation gate which is arranged between the connecting ends of the flexible thermocouples and the digital display instrument. The direct temperature measuring device can be installed on a variety of thermal treatment equipment such as a plasma thermal treatment furnace. With the direct temperature measuring device adopted, the temperatures at multiple points in a thermal reaction device can be measured directly.

Description

Technical field [0001] The invention relates to a temperature measurement device, a plasma heat treatment furnace applying the device and a temperature measurement method using the device for temperature measurement. Background technique [0002] The temperature measuring device is a commonly used device in the field of thermal reaction and heat treatment. In order to monitor the thermal reaction or heat treatment temperature, control the thermal reaction or heat treatment effect, it is necessary to monitor the temperature of the thermal reaction device, the temperature inside the heat treatment device, or the temperature of the workpiece to be processed inside the heat treatment. Due to the high temperature environment inside the thermal reaction or heat treatment device, ordinary temperature measuring devices are not suitable, and special temperature measuring devices are required.
